BADAR DURREZ AHMED, J.
1. By way of this writ petition the petitioner seeks the benefit of Section 24(2) of the Right to Fair Compensation and Transparency in Land Acquisition, Rehabilitation and Resettlement Act, 2013 (hereinafter referred to as the “2013 Act”) which came into effect on 01.01.2014. The petitioner, consequently, seeks a declaration that the acquisition proceeding initiated under the Land Acquisition Act, 1894 (hereinafter referred to as the “1894 Act”) and in respect of which Award No. 42/1987-88 dated 26.05.1987 was made, inter alia, in respect of the petitioner’s land, comprised in Khasra Nos. 662/1 (1-2), 662/2 (3-14), 664 min (4-3) measuring 8 Bighas and 19 Biswas in all in village Satbari, New Delhi, shall be deemed to have lapsed.
2. Although the Land Acquisition Collector has stated that possession of the subject land was taken, it is evident from the order of this Court dated 08.03.2010 in WP(C) 14769/2006 that possession had not been taken. The respondents also contended that the amount of compensation was deposited in the treasury, although the same had not been paid to the land owner nor was it offered to her.
